Epoxy primer Teknobond 300 without solvents, 5 l TEKNO
Teknobond 300 is a two-component epoxy primer with low viscosity.
Where it is used:
- For indoor and outdoor work.
- As a protective coating on industrial concrete surfaces.
- As a primer before laying polyurethane or epoxy floor coverings.
- Warehouses, factories, parking lots.
Features and Benefits:
- It does not contain solvents.
- It has very good adhesion to concrete and cement screed.
- It has good penetrating properties.
- Resistant to dilute acids and dense alkalis, cleaning agents and detergents.
- Vegetable, mineral and animal oils, fresh and sea water, gasoline, alcohol and many solvents.
Instructions for use
- The surface for application must be cleaned of any kind of oil, rust, detergents and other substances that prevent setting. If there are areas in the form of cracks, cavities on the surface - they should be repaired with the help of convenient mixtures Teknorep 300 and Teknorep 300EX.
- Use at ambient temperature 10°C... 30°C.
- Mixing should be carried out with a mixer at a speed of 300-400 rpm until a homogeneous mixture is formed. Do not mix by hand.
- Before mixing, pre-prepare components A and B to a temperature of 15 °C ... 25 °C.
- Tools after applying Teknobond 300 must be cleaned immediately with TEKNO TINER, since after solidification it can only be cleaned mechanically.
|
Colour |
Transparent |
|
Packaging |
5 L |
|
Expiration date |
12 months in a dry environment in a closed package |
|
Density of the mixture (TS EN 2811-1) |
1.10 0.02 g/ml |
|
Life time of the mixture |
> 30 min (may vary depending on weather conditions) |
|
Drying time of the layer |
24 - 72 hours |
|
Mixture ratio |
2 component A: 1 component B |
|
The time of complete drying of the material |
7 days |
|
Application temperature |
+10 °C...+30 °C |
|
Surface humidity |
< 4 % |
|
Relative humidity |
up to 80 % |
|
Expenditure |
300 - 500 g/m2 (with a thickness of 1 mm) |
|
Flexural strength (TS EN 196-1) |
> 30 N/mm2 |
|
Compressive strength (TS EN 196-1) |
> 90 N/mm2 |
|
Adhesion to concrete surfaces (TS EN 4624) |
> 4 N/mm2 |
|
Adhesion to metal surfaces (TS EN 4624) |
< 3 N/mm2 |
|
Shore D Hardness |
83 |
|
Thermal stability |
+50 °C |
